The biggest FTSE 100 risers were Astra-Zeneca up 586.5p at 4666.5p, Sainsbury’s ahead 8.4p at 330.5p, William Hill up 8.1p at 348.1p and Shire ahead 76p at 3286p.

High-profile fallers in the top flight included Royal Bank of Scotland, which fell 7.7p to 295.5p, and Royal Mail after a drop of 8p to 511.5p.

The pound held on to recent gains against the US dollar and euro as investors awaited Tuesday’s publicatio­n of GDP figures for the first quarter of the year.

Economists are pencilling in a figure of 0.9%, which would take UK output within a whisker of its pre-crisis peak.

Sterling was flat against the US dollar at 1.68 and versus the euro at 1.21.
